Recent Federal Bills

Below are summaries of Bills Introduced, Committee Reports, Chamber Actions, and Public Laws reported in the most recent issue of ELR's Weekly Update.

would amend the Asbestos Information Act to establish a public database of asbestos-containing products, and require public disclosure of information pertaining to the manufacture, processing, distribution, and use of asbestos-containing products.

 

would extend the deadline for commencement of construction of a hydroelectric project involving the Gibson Dam.

would reinstate and extend the deadline for commencement of construction of a hydroelectric project involving the Clark Canyon Dam.

would require state and local government approval of prescribed burns on federal land during conditions of drought or fire danger.

would amend the Robert T. Stafford Disaster Relief and Emergency Assistance Act to provide eligibility for broadcasting facilities to receive certain disaster assistance.

would prohibit the expenditure of federal funds to Amtrak.

would end the use of body gripping traps in the National Wildlife Refuge System.

would authorize DOI to carry out programs and activities that connect Americans, especially children, youth, and families, with the outdoors.

would amend the Magnuson-Stevens Fishery Conservation and Management Act to authorize competitive grants to support programs that address needs of fishing communities.

would provide for the conveyance of certain land inholdings owned by the United States to the Pascua Yaqui Tribe of Arizona.
